It will most likely improve. My battery life was not too great the first few days either, but now it seems to have settled in quite nicely. After a full day of work I usually am still safely in the green on the battery meter, typically between 70 and 80%. And that's with poor cell signal at work all day.
How is that possible? Does it sit in your pocket all day?
 
How is that possible? Does it sit in your pocket all day?
I've got it tuned exactly how I need it. Don't have a bunch of unnecessary syncing going on, keep the brightness turned down a bit, and have wifi on so my low cell signal doesn't totally murder the battery.

I don't use it a ton, since I'm in front of a computer and desk phone anyway, but I usually get a couple quick calls, 20 or so text messages, some emails, and a few minutes of games here and there.

You will have the processing power with the 3D. The 2 phones are not that far apart stock. Using them you won't be able to tell the difference. Also according to nenamark the GPU in the 3D is better than the Tegra 2, when running the same screen resolution. These benchmarks just don't transfer to real world use. They are for bragging rights. But to answer your final question, yes an overclocked EVO 3D will smoke a stock Photon.

look better... a little subjective for phone... but there will be a lot of games that run a lot smoother on the Tegra 2. At the same time, there are very few games targeted at that for minimum specs. I don't see too many competitive people needing super frame rate for their FPS games on a cellphone. All the games I've played work just fine for the 3D. The clock speed can also be a little misleading at times, but cellphone apps don't need fast processors to get the job done (unless you're starting a 3d render farm of EVOs).
